Description

Shareholders of a certain company and a particular purchaser executed an Asset Purchase Agreement. The shareholders agree to defend, and hold the purchaser harmless against any and all damages, loss, liability, or deficiency sustained or incurred by purchaser which arises out of or results from any liability or obligation which may become due.

Georgia Indemnification Agreement for Personal Property refers to a legally binding contract that outlines the terms and conditions for compensation and protection of personal property in the state of Georgia. This agreement ensures that individuals or entities are indemnified against any loss, damage, or liability related to personal property. An Indemnification Agreement for Personal Property in Georgia typically includes important details such as the names and contact information of the parties involved, a description of the personal property being indemnified, the effective date of the agreement, and the duration of the agreement. This agreement also specifies the scope of indemnification, outlining the extent to which the indemnifying party will provide compensation or cover costs related to damage, loss, theft, or any other event impacting the personal property. It establishes the responsibilities of both parties, highlighting the obligations of the indemnity to protect and maintain the property, as well as the duty of the indemnity to notify the indemnity promptly of any damages or losses. To indemnify someone is to absolve that person from responsibility for damage or loss arising from a transaction. Indemnification is the act of not being held liable for or being protected from harm, loss, or damages, by shifting the liability to another party.

"Each party agrees to indemnify, defend, and hold harmless the other party from and against any loss, cost, or damage of any kind (including reasonable outside attorneys' fees) to the extent arising out of its breach of this Agreement, and/or its negligence or willful misconduct."

At their core, indemnification provisions transfer liabilities related to a claim from one party to another party, generally in the event of a breach of contract or a party's negligence or misconduct in the performance of the agreement.

California courts have held that indemnify and hold harmless confer distinct rights: (1) Indemnify is an offensive right, allowing the indemnified party to seek indemnification from the indemnifying party; (2) Hold harmless is a defensive right, protecting the indemnified party from being bothered by the other

Indemnification provisions are generally enforceable. There are certain exceptions however. Indemnifications that require a party to indemnify another party for any claim irrespective of fault ('broad form' or 'no fault' indemnities) generally have been found to violate public policy.

Example 1: A service provider asking their customer to indemnify them to protect against misuse of their work product. Example 2: A rental car company, as the rightful owner of the car, having their customer indemnify them from any damage caused by the customer during the course of the retnal.
